Biographical history
Harry Graham Barker, 1894-1959, was born in Carman, Manitoba and attented Manitoba Agricultural College in 1914-1915. He served as a gunner in the First World War in the 78th Depot Battery. His family had moved to Okotoks, Alberta in 1906 and after some years Harry moved to Turner Valley to work. His sister Anna Barker, 1900-1998, married H. J. Trenholm. Hinson Joseph Trenholm, 1896-1951, was born in Port Elgin, New Brunswick. He served in the First World War, in the 1st Depot Battalion, Nova Scotia Regiment, and returned to Canada in 1919. He later moved to Alberta where he worked in the gas plant in Turner Valley.

Scope and content
The fonds consists of military and family correspondence, ca. 1920s-1950s, greeting cards, and photographs of farming, Banff and Barker/Trenholm family.
